What Are Mortgage Loan Pre-Approvals?
A home loan pre-approval serves as a stamp of approval from lenders confirming your financial readiness to buy a home. Before you get pre-approved, the lender will evaluate your debt-to-income ratio and creditworthiness. Upon approval, you will receive a statement that serves as their conditional commitment to lending you money to buy your home while also showing how much they are willing to give you.
Pre-approval Vs Prequalification - What's The Difference?
A prequalification gives you a rough idea of how much you can borrow based on what you tell the lender about your finances. Pre-approval, on the other hand, means the lender has checked and confirmed your financial information, giving you a conditional thumbs-up for a specific loan amount.
When Should You Get Pre-Approved?
You can get approved for a mortgage in as little as one business day if your paperwork is in order, while other lenders may take longer. Pre-approvals are usually valid for 90 days. However, some lenders may keep it valid for 30 or 60 days.

Do Pre-approvals Affect Your Credit Score?
Before you get preapproved for a mortgage, lenders carry out a hard pull of your credit to check your score, temporarily lowering it by a few points. However, you will have a 45-day window in which multiple credit score inquiries will be considered on your credit report. Are you worried about denial? Pre-Approval Costs in Imperial County, California
You may be wondering if you need to pay money to get pre-approved for a mortgage loan in Imperial County, California. That depends on the lender you choose to work with. Some do it for free, while others demand a non-refundable application fee you must pay upfront, whether you get approved or not.

Local Considerations in Imperial County, California
Imperial County, California, presents unique opportunities and challenges for those seeking mortgage pre-approval. Understanding the local housing market trends is essential, as the average home value stands at $368,304, with a 5.3% increase over the past year and homes going to pending in about 19 days.
